According to our (Global Info Research) latest study, the global Matrix Splicing Processor market size was valued at US$ 734 million in 2025 and is forecast to a readjusted size of US$ 1251 million by 2032 with a CAGR of 7.9% during review period.
A matrix splicing processor is a video image processing device that integrates the functions of "signal matrix switching" and "multi-screen splicing display." Its primary function is to receive, switch, scale, split, overlay, and synchronously output multiple input signals (such as HDMI, DVI, DP, SDI, and network video), and to display one or more video feeds—arranged according to a preset layout—across multiple spliced screens, large-format LED displays, or projection blending systems. Possessing both the multi-input/multi-output distribution capabilities of a matrix switcher and the image processing features of a video splicer—including image splitting, window roaming, cross-screen display, Picture-in-Picture (PiP), and resolution adaptation—this device is widely deployed in scenarios such as command centers, dispatch centers, security surveillance hubs, conference and presentation venues, exhibition halls, broadcasting and television studios, and smart city infrastructure.
The upstream segment of the matrix splicing processor industry chain primarily comprises video processing chips, FPGAs/SoCs, interface chips, memory modules, power supply modules, PCBs, capacitors and resistors, heat sinks, chassis structural components, interface modules (for HDMI, DP, DVI, SDI, fiber optics, etc.), and control software algorithms. The midstream segment consists of the matrix splicing processor manufacturers themselves, who are responsible for hardware design, signal reception and switching, image scaling, screen splitting, window roaming, cross-screen display, synchronous output, and control software development. The downstream segment targets end-use scenarios such as command centers, security surveillance, traffic dispatch, energy and power management, defense and emergency response, conferences and exhibitions, broadcasting studios, education and training, commercial displays, and smart cities; these processors are typically sold in conjunction with LCD splicing screens, large-format LED displays, projection blending systems, distributed seating systems, and central control systems. The gross profit margin for matrix splicing processors stands at approximately 43%.
In 2025, the average selling price of matrix splicing processors is projected to be $1,710 per unit, with sales volume reaching 417 k units and total production capacity standing at 520 k units.
The matrix splicing processor serves as the "signal dispatch hub" for large-screen display systems, with demand primarily stemming from sectors such as command and dispatch, security surveillance, transportation, electric power, emergency response, and smart cities. As the volume of various business systems, surveillance feeds, GIS maps, data dashboards, and collaborative meeting content continues to grow, the display screens themselves are no longer sufficient to meet the demands for multi-signal processing, multi-window display, cross-screen visualization, and rapid switching. Consequently, the true value of a matrix splicing processor extends far beyond merely "stitching screens together"; it lies in enabling the unified access, flexible scheduling, seamless fusion, and centralized control of signals from multiple sources. For mid-to-high-end projects, key procurement priorities include low latency, system stability, redundant design, robust access control, and the capability for continuous 24/7 operation.
Industry competition is shifting from a sole focus on hardware specifications to a comprehensive contest involving "hardware + software + system integration capabilities." In the low-end segment, matrix splicing processor products suffer from significant homogenization and fierce price competition, with vendors primarily competing on the number of input/output channels, resolution support, and interface quantity. In contrast, the mid-to-high-end market places greater emphasis on device compatibility, intuitive visualization control software, operator seat collaboration, distributed deployment architectures, KVM management, IP-based transmission capabilities, and seamless integration with LED, LCD, and projection display systems. In the future, manufacturers that offer only standalone hardware products will face shrinking profit margins; conversely, companies possessing capabilities in control software development, project customization, system interlinking, and comprehensive after-sales service will enjoy higher gross margins and greater customer loyalty.
Future trends in this sector point toward high-definition resolution, IP-based networking, distributed architectures, and intelligent automation. Driven by the proliferation of 4K/8K signals, fine-pitch LED large screens, real-world 3D modeling, digital twin technologies, and the construction of smart city operation centers, matrix splicing processors are poised to evolve beyond traditional centralized chassis-based hardware. Instead, they will gradually transition toward distributed video nodes, network-centric signal management, and cloud-based visualization control platforms. Concurrently, advanced features such as AI-driven video analytics, automated layout optimization, predictive fault alerting, remote operation and maintenance, and multi-system linkage will emerge as key selling points. Overall, while the prices of low-end products are expected to continue their downward trend, high-end application scenarios—such as sophisticated command centers, energy dispatch hubs, traffic control centers, and emergency management systems—will continue to sustain the high added value associated with professional-grade matrix splicing processors.
